Default What has to be changed on a M6 car to convert to a TH400?

I'm considering doing the swap and was wondering what exactly has to be changed? I have LS1edit, so I don't think that it would be a problem....or do I need an auto PCM?

Default Re: What has to be changed on a M6 car to convert to a TH400?

No, you don't need an Auto PCM, actually the manual flash file is what you want. You will of course have a wiring job to do. And a lot of codes to delete. I went from A4 to TH400.
